PSY 200 - Psychology as a Natural Science

Institution:
Portland State University
Subject:
Psychology
Description:
Covers the scientific foundations of human behavior in areas such as physiological and biological psychology, cognitive, moral, and emotional development, sensation and perception, consciousness, learning, thinking and memory. Also focuses on issues in experimental design and teaches students how to critically evaluate psychological research.
